Volodymyr Zelensky's plane was reportedly "almost hit" by a Russian drone shortly after take-off from Moldova on Tuesday, as the Ukrainian president travelled to Oslo for the funeral of Norway's King Harald V. Norwegian Prime Minister Jonas Gahr Stoere disclosed the incident to public broadcaster NRK, though he did not specify his source or how close the drone had come. A source within the Ukrainian presidency gave a more measured account, saying an alert had been triggered when a Russian drone entered Moldovan and Romanian airspace, and dismissed suggestions that Zelensky had been in danger as "exaggerated".

Zelensky arrived in Oslo on Tuesday evening and held talks with Stoere, Finance Minister Jens Stoltenberg and Foreign Minister Espen Barth Eide on Norwegian military support, including air-defence assistance and the FREYJA anti-ballistic missile programme, an effort to develop alternatives to US-made Patriot interceptors. On Wednesday he joined other foreign dignitaries, including Prince William, at King Harald's funeral in central Oslo, marching behind the coffin. The king died on 28 August aged 89. Zelensky departed Norway after the service to begin talks in Canada.
